[Update the algorithm to handle roles where naming is not supported](https://github.com/w3c/accname/pull/53)

https://github.com/w3c/accname/pull/53

<jamesn> https://raw.githack.com/w3c/accname/issue-52/index.html#step1

jamesn: Adds a statement to the end of step 1 in the algorithm

<jamesn> If the root node's role does not support naming, return the empty string ("").

<joanie> <span aria-label="bar">foo</span>: The span has no name.

<joanie> <button><span aria-label="bar">foo</span></button>: The button's

<joanie> accessible name is "bar" (but the span itself has no name).

joanie: If you can't put a name on this thing for whatever reason, then return early.

mck: So HTML AAM can override for specific elements, like div?

joanie: Yes, technically, they are allowed to do this. (don't know why they would, but it's their host language).

mck: So the role can be implied or explicit.

joanie: yep

<jamesn> https://www.w3.org/TR/html-aria/#div

jamesn: HTML conformance is stated in "ARIA in HTML"

scott: Steve and I will update these documents once the changes land in ARIA
... we have no desire to allow names on div

the platform accessibility API's also use the word "group", and ARIA "group" maps to it, but the AccName step 1 applies only to the platform-agnostic ARIA role "group"

Proposed change: If the root node's role prohibits naming, return the empty string ("").
